Yaqui vs Peruvian No Schooling Completed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 107,378,614 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Yaqui and percentage of population with no schooling in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.024 and weighted average of 2.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 360,290,291 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Peruvians and percentage of population with no schooling in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.151 and weighted average of 2.4%, a difference of 1.8%.
